Having been around since George Lucas' earliest drafts, Peter Mayhew, who originated the role of Chewbacca, is now taking to Twitter to share pages of a very early draft of Episode IV: A New Hope!

Mayhew, who played the Wookiee in the original trilogy, one of the films of the second trilogy and so far the only movie of the third one, certainly knows his way around the Star Wars universe.

According to The Verge, while many diehard fans of Lucas' story of a galaxy far, far away might know what happened in the earliest drafts of the first film, more casual fans should still get a kick out of the first pages of a very different script.

Originally called The Adventures of Luke Starkiller, the screenplay Mayhew is posting page by page is from March 1976, only weeks before filming began.

"The Adventures of Luke Starkiller as taken from the Journal of the Whills by George Lucas reads completely different from what Star Wars Episode IV eventually became," reads a statement from Mayhew, via Slash Film. "Peter's script along with Peter's wookiee coffee thumbprints and notes scrawled on the pages are a treat to read and brings us back to the root of what made Star Wars great."

Mayhew is releasing his own copy of the original New Hope to the public as a countdown, posting pages of the script on Twitter to lead up to what he's calling a "big announcement," possibly regarding Episode 8. Although Chewbacca, along with Harrison Ford's Han Solo, was a major part of last year's Star Wars: The Force Awakens, when Disney's Lucasfilm released the cast sheet for Episode 8, currently in production, Mayhew's name wasn't on it. Could the actor be announcing his actual involvement (or not) in the new movie?

The still-untitled sequel Star Wars: Episode VIII, directed by Rian Johnson, will hit theaters on Dec. 17, 2017.
